Former Nigerian Vice President and presidential hopeful Atiku Abubakar has extended heartfelt sympathies to heavyweight boxing champion Anthony Joshua after a tragic auto collision in Ogun State left two fatalities.
Taking to his official X account, Atiku conveyed his sorrow over the incident, offering prayers for Joshua’s speedy recuperation.
“My heart goes out to @anthonyjoshua following today’s devastating accident along the Sagamu expressway. The boxing legend embodies perseverance, and I’m confident he’ll overcome this challenge. My thoughts are with him during this painful period,” the statement read.
The seasoned politician also expressed profound grief for the bereaved families, adding:
“Words cannot ease the pain of those mourning loved ones lost in this tragedy. May divine peace comfort the affected families as they navigate this heartbreaking loss.”
Reports indicate the collision occurred mid-morning near Makun’s Danco Filling Station when Joshua’s convoy vehicle reportedly rear-ended a parked truck.
Eyewitness accounts describe a harrowing scene where Joshua’s Lexus SUV (plate KRD 850 HN) collided violently with the stationary vehicle. While the boxing icon escaped with minor wounds, two fellow passengers succumbed to fatal injuries immediately.
“The impact was catastrophic – the front passenger and rear seat occupant perished instantly. FRSC personnel responded promptly to manage the emergency,” recounted an onlooker familiar with rescue efforts.
